Two additional notes:
(1) Rutgers/Newark will be an exhibition team, not competing for the
title. Texas A&M *may* be competing as an exhibition team.
(2) As far as bracketing goes, the only things I can say before the
tournament are:
* Teams from the same school will not play each other unless it is
absolutely unavoidable.
* Teams that are traveling long distances will be separated as much
as possible. So, for example, Louisiana/Lafayette, Rice, and Texas
A&M will not play one another unless it is absolutely unavoidable. In
any case, every effort will be made to separate A teams as much as
possible.
* The semifinalists from last year (Yale I, Virginia I, Michigan I)
will not play in the same preliminary brackets.
* The brackets *will* be seeded to keep the brackets as even as
possible in terms of both strength and geographic diversity.
